def main(options):

    #load the config params
    gpu = options['gpu']
    data_path = options['path_dataset']
    embeddings_path = options['path_vectors']
    n_epoch = options['epochs']
    batchsize = options['batchsize']
    test = options['test']
    embed_dim = options['embed_dim']
    freeze = options['freeze_embeddings']

    #load the data
    data_processor = DataProcessor(data_path, test)
    data_processor.prepare_dataset()
    train_data = data_processor.train_data
    dev_data = data_processor.dev_data
    test_data = data_processor.test_data

    vocab = data_processor.vocab
    cnn = CNN(n_vocab=len(vocab), input_channel=1,
                  output_channel=10, n_label=2, embed_dim=embed_dim, freeze=freeze)
    cnn.load_embeddings(embeddings_path, data_processor.vocab)
    model = L.Classifier(cnn)
    if gpu >= 0:
        model.to_gpu()

    #setup the optimizer
    optimizer = O.Adam()
    optimizer.setup(model)


    train_iter = chainer.iterators.SerialIterator(train_data, batchsize)
    dev_iter = chainer.iterators.SerialIterator(dev_data, batchsize,repeat=False, shuffle=False)
    test_iter = chainer.iterators.SerialIterator(test_data, batchsize,repeat=False, shuffle=False) 
    batch1 = train_iter.next()
    batch2 = dev_iter.next()
    updater = training.StandardUpdater(train_iter, optimizer, converter=util.concat_examples, device=gpu)
    trainer = training.Trainer(updater, (n_epoch, 'epoch'))

    # Evaluation
    eval_model = model.copy()
    eval_model.predictor.train = False
    trainer.extend(extensions.Evaluator(dev_iter, eval_model, device=gpu, converter=util.concat_examples))

    test_model = model.copy()
    test_model.predictor.train = False

    trainer.extend(extensions.LogReport())
    trainer.extend(extensions.PrintReport(
        ['epoch', 'main/loss', 'validation/main/loss',
         'main/accuracy', 'validation/main/accuracy']))
    trainer.extend(extensions.ProgressBar(update_interval=10))


    trainer.run()
